What is the relationship between Tang Xiaoying and Ye Qinqin?
The relationship between Tang Xiaoying and Ye Qinqin is a high school classmate:

Tang Xiaoying and Ye Qinqin are from the novel The Battle of the Roses. Ye Qinqin and Tang Xiaoying are high school classmates. It turns out that this so-called Ye Qinqin's real name is Tang Xiaoying. She and Ye Qinqin are high school classmates. Under his father's arrangement, Tang Xiaoying stole Ye Qinqin's identity and went to college instead of Ye Qinqin. Rick Fang revealed the secret between Ye Qinqin and Tang Xiaoying, and Ye Qinqin also took Tang Xiaoying to court.

Qin Qin and Tang Xiaoying in the final outcome of the battle of the roses is:

Ye Qinqin and Tang Xiaoying finally chose reconciliation to bury the hatchet. However, after all, Tang Xiaoying did something wrong and finally got the punishment she deserved.

In the criminal part, Tang Xiaoying's father was sentenced to four years' imprisonment, while Tang Xiaoying was sentenced to six months' detention and suspended sentence. After all, she was not an adult at that time.

As for the civil compensation, Tang Xiaoying stopped pretending. She and her father also publicly apologized to Ye Qinqin, and the two sides also discussed a reasonable amount of compensation for mental damage.
